com.aelitis.azureus.core.backup
Interface BackupManager

All Known Implementing Classes:
BackupManagerImpl

public interface BackupManager


Nested Class Summary
static interface BackupManager.BackupListener
           
 
Method Summary
 void backup(java.io.File parent_folder, BackupManager.BackupListener listener)
           
 java.lang.String getLastBackupError()
           
 long getLastBackupTime()
           
 void restore(java.io.File backup_folder, BackupManager.BackupListener listener)
           
 void runAutoBackup(BackupManager.BackupListener listener)
           
 

Method Detail

backup

void backup(java.io.File parent_folder,
            BackupManager.BackupListener listener)

restore

void restore(java.io.File backup_folder,
             BackupManager.BackupListener listener)

runAutoBackup

void runAutoBackup(BackupManager.BackupListener listener)

getLastBackupTime

long getLastBackupTime()

getLastBackupError

java.lang.String getLastBackupError()